#bcca08 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bcca08 is composed of 73.7% red, 79.2%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 96%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 64.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 41.2%. #bcca08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#799500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#bcca08 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bcca08 has RGB values of R:188, G:202,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 12372488.

Hex triplet bcca08 #bcca08
RGB Decimal 188, 202, 8 rgb(188,202,8)
RGB Percent 73.7, 79.2, 3.1 rgb(73.7%,79.2%,3.1%)
CMYK 7, 0, 96, 21
HSL 64.3°, 92.4, 41.2 hsl(64.3,92.4%,41.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 64.3°, 96, 79.2
Web Safe cccc00 #cccc00
CIE-LAB 77.846, -23.961, 77.197
XYZ 41.903, 52.95, 8.243
xyY 0.406, 0.514, 52.95
CIE-LCH 77.846, 80.83, 107.244
CIE-LUV 77.846, -3.179, 86.246
Hunter-Lab 72.767, -24.552, 44.221
Binary 10111100, 11001010, 00001000

Shades and Tints of #bcca08

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d01 is the darkest color, while #fefff9 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#bcca08 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b0b0b0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b2b58e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#dbc40f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#f4ba2b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#cebfcc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d0c60c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dfc01e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c8c385 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
